What are H-1B salaries in McKinney?

Based on 318 certified LCA filings, H-1B workers in McKinney, TX earn an average salary of $116,413. The salary range spans from $58,206 to $232,826 depending on role, company, and experience level.

Source: US Department of Labor LCA Disclosure Data, Q1 FY2025

How accurate is this salary data?

This data comes from official US Department of Labor Labor Condition Application (LCA) filings. Companies are legally required to report accurate salary information on these forms—lying constitutes federal fraud. This makes our data more reliable than self-reported salary sites.
